Godberson takes County Commission seat

Ponca City Now - November 14, 2017 8:30 pm

In unofficial results, Republican Jack Godberson took 65.14 percent of the vote in the Kay County District 1 Commissioner race.

Democrat John Leven took 34.86 percent of the votes cast in the race.

Results remain unofficial until they are certified on Friday.

A total of 895 votes were cast in the race, which was a special election to fill the position left vacant after the death of Commissioner Vance Johnson.
